Output e60b8071f1e468826bb8a767dfd5a47c313e009ea0303c882f18303329093a26:1

value
288551403
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 72962364799297af08c6efebf5f4339384717781 OP_EQUALVERIFY OP_CHECKSIG
address
1BSstf886tJ6edgmCJkAaacdacsXLSHb3t
transaction
e60b8071f1e468826bb8a767dfd5a47c313e009ea0303c882f18303329093a26
confirmations
38869
spent
true